Releases: appirio-tech/connect-app
Connect 2.4.5 - Polished Connect-V3 Project Plan Section
- This release contains Many UI related changes for improved and polished UX for Connect-V3. Few of the major changes are -
- Mobile UI changes
- Phase topics in left panel
- Improved view of Timeline/milestones
- Improved view of phase edit form
- Post 2.4.4 release fixes
- Changing project status based on project plan activity
- Optimising API calls to reduce latency
Milestone to track this release was - https://github.com/appirio-tech/connect-app/milestone/56
Connect 2.4.3 release - Introducing Project Plan
This release introduces project plan for new projects which allows creating a simple game plan for the project that is divided in phases.
Connect V3 - MVP Prod Release [ProjectPlan & Timelines]
This release in Connect has significantly improved our milestone (timeline) and chat functionality. Read below for a recap on the benefits of this release.
Also note that brief demo video will be following shortly to showcase the functionality.
- Phase timeline (new feature):
- See in details what are the milestones in each phase, and where we are on the process
- Milestones are interactive - select your design options, final designs, or prototypes directly from the phase timeline; and allow the customer quickly to make a decision on important questions
- Delivery on the timeline - final deliverables are provided as a .zip archive at the end of the phase, and stay available for the customer indefinitely
- The timeline is an accurate picture of when things are going to happen - each milestone has a planned date; and once a milestone is reached, we have a historical record of what happened on the project.
- Fullscreen chat (new feature):
- Focus on your conversation in fullscreen mode (double arrows on the post card);
- Navigate between all your discussion topics (on the left sidebar).
- Numerous small bugs and improvements
multiple milestones contributed to this release
Email bundling and settings updates
This release added following features to the product:
- Connect's own email settings page instead of redirecting user to the profile page for email settings updates which never had connect related email settings.
- Bundling support for notifications emails (this release only sends emails for messaging events, we would add support for rest of the project events in upcoming release)
- Mobile friendly error and new customer's landing page
We have also synced the release version with the our internal product management tool's releases. So, this release is 2.4.2 instead of 1.5.2.
Connect Mobile Responsive - Phase II (Final Changes)
Final changes for the Connect mobile responsive are part of this release.Feature/Pages made responsive are -
1.Creating a project
2.Notifications
3.Notifications Setting
4.Specifications
Other than responsive changes, change for showing sorted notifications to the user is also part of the release
Dependent release which contains phase-I changes for mobile responsiveness -
Discourse free messaging backend and responsiveness for mobile
- Now it is backed via our own database instead of discourse. We should not be limited by discourse limitation any more.
- Now we have a link in notification email which takes user to the project’s discussion page.
- Supports email forwarding for cases where local part of both the emails are same
- Only posts the content of current email when replying the notification email to post a comment
- Support better filtering of email notifications where a user is mentioned. Now you can filter out your mentioned emails with
cc
filter for a specific email address(e.g. mentioned DOT connect AT topcoder DOT com). - This release does not support expanding of links using meta or open graph tags. Discourse based messaging used to support that. We may support this feature in upcoming releases.
- This release also supports mobile responsive UI. It includes phase 1 changes only.
Other dependency releases to support this release:
Patch release for 1.4.4
Fixed error in loading specification page for generic design projects
Fixed bug with projects filter
Bug fixes and minor features
#1437, Page update reload suggestion. Now user gets suggestions to reload the page when new content is available.
#1462, Code refactor to load cleaner JSON files instead of repeated JS functions
#1458, Fix price quote mechanism
#1453 Project tags must be clickable and used as search term
Circle CI upgrade to 2.0
#1403, Handle null values for gclid - Google Click Id from Connect to Salesforce
do not auto-reload when feed is changed
fix reload button location
mark all feed update read in componentDidMount
#1575 - Sorting the project list view should not reload the page if we have all the data
#1632 Move My Projects switch inline with the view switch tab
#1603 Search box performance issue
#1615 Adding member without image (avatar component) isn't rendered correctly in auto-suggest box
#1636 - Limit the number of manager profiles on card view to fit
Many other style fixes around messaging and other areas of the application.
Admin functionality update 01
-- Changes required for connect milestone Admin functionality update 01
-- #1243, Connect Admin role
-- #1371, Admins should be able to add people to a project without joining
-- fixes for few tech debt issues
fyi @vic-topcoder @mtwomey
Project listing updates (milestone 14)
Admins can change project status without joining the project
Card view for customers
Added new fields for budget and deadline
New navigation link for customers
Improved project details side bar
Incomplete project is dropping ref code
Removed cancelled projects from customer view
Bug fixes
For more details https://github.com/appirio-tech/connect-app/milestone/14